RAD’s activities include themed reading, craft activities and kid-friendly community service projects that are geared towards elementary aged students and their families. RAD’s programs are held at Torresdale Library and operate during the months of October thru June on 2nd Saturdays monthly from 1:00 pm - 3:00 pm. All activities and events are always free!
